Su Z, Ling Q, Guo ZG. Effects of lysophosphatidylcholine on bovine aortic endothelial cells in culture. CARDIOSCIENCE 1995; 6:31-7. Abstract
To elucidate the vascular actions of lysophosphatidylcholine, we examined its effects on the concentration of cytosolic free calcium ([Ca2+]i), plasma membrane fluidity and release of lactate dehydrogenase in vascular endothelial cells cultured from bovine aortas. The [Ca2+]i of the endothelial cells was measured by a dual-wavelength fluorospectrophotometer using a fluorescent, calcium-specific indicator, Fura-2. Membrane fluidity was monitored by measuring changes in the steady-state fluorescence anisotropies, using 1,6-diphenyl-1,3,5-hexatriene as a fluorescence probe. In the presence of 1 mmol/L extracellular calcium, lysophosphatidylcholine caused a biphasic elevation of [Ca2+]i in Fura-2-loaded vascular endothelial cells, consisting of a large transient component followed by a relatively low, but more sustained component. At concentrations of lysophosphatidylcholine equal to or greater than 10 mumol/L, [Ca2+]i increased in a dose-dependent manner in the presence or absence of external calcium. In the absence of extracellular calcium, only an initial transient increment in the [Ca2+]i of endothelial cells was generated, the sustained component being eliminated. The sustained component was greatly depressed or almost abolished by the addition of the calcium influx blocker, NiCl2. Plasma membrane fluidity was greatly increased by incubation with lysophosphatidylcholine (30 and 50 mumol/L) concomitant with significant increases in the release of lactate dehydrogenase from the cells. At 50 mumol/L, lysophosphatidylcholine increased lactate dehydrogenase release and membrane fluidity in a time-related way.(ABSTRACT TRUNCATED AT 250 WORDS)

Ren Z, Ding W, Su Z, Gu X, Huang H, Liu J, Yan Q, Zhang W, Yu X. Mechanisms of brain injury with deep hypothermic circulatory arrest and protective effects of coenzyme Q10. Abstract
Sixteen dogs, divided randomly into a control group and coenzyme Q10 group (10mg/kg, intraperitoneally before the operation), underwent deep hypothermic circulatory arrest with cardiopulmonary bypass, as is done clinically. At four time points cerebral cortex and cerebrospinal fluid specimens were collected to study free radical formation, energy metabolism, and ultrastructure. During cardiopulmonary bypass cerebral electron spin resonance spectra and malondialdehyde contents were progressively higher than before bypass, especially at the 60 minutes of circulatory arrest and 30 minutes of reperfusion (p1 < 0.01, p2 < 0.05). In the coenzyme Q10 group at the latter two time points, they had increased less than in the control group at same time points (p1 < 0.02, p2 < 0.005). Adenosine triphosphate content in the cortex during bypass decreased gradually from the prebypass level (p1 < 0.02, p2 = p3 < 0.001), while lactate in cerebrospinal fluid increased (p1 < 0.05, p2 = p3 < 0.001). In the coenzyme Q10 group, adenosine triphosphate at the latter two time points was greater than that in the control group (p1 = p2 < 0.05), while the lactate changes were not significantly different from control at each time point (all p > 0.05). Ultrastructure of the cortex was normal before bypass and almost normal during bypass, but it was obviously abnormal at 60 minutes of circulatory arrest and more seriously abnormal at 30 minutes of reperfusion. In the coenzyme Q10 group the abnormality was obviously reduced. The results suggest that oxygen-derived free radicals and abnormal energy metabolism might play critical roles in brain ischemia/reperfusion injury. Coenzyme Q10 could protect the brain by improving cerebral metabolism.

Su Z, Fan D, George SE. Role of domain 3 of calmodulin in activation of calmodulin-stimulated phosphodiesterase and smooth muscle myosin light chain kinase. J Biol Chem 1994; 269:16761-5. Abstract
CaM[3 TnC] is a calmodulin-cardiac troponin C chimeric protein containing the first, second, and fourth calcium-binding domains of calmodulin (CaM) and the third calcium-binding domain of cardiac troponin C (cTnC) (George, S. E., Su, Z., Fan, D., and Means, A. R. (1993) J. Biol. Chem. 268, 25213-25220). CaM[3 TnC] shows altered activation of phosphodiesterase (PDE) and is a potent competitive inhibitor of smooth muscle myosin light chain kinase (smMLCK) activation by CaM. To determine why CaM[3 TnC] exhibits altered target enzyme interactions, we constructed a series of domain 3 CaM mutants. We began with subdomain substitutions, replacing most of CaM's helix 5, Ca2+ binding loop 3, and helix 6 with the corresponding subdomains of cTnC. Only CaM[helix 6-TnC] exhibited significant impairment of smMLCK and PDE activation. We then individually substituted the residues in the region of CaM's helix 6 with the corresponding cTnC residue. This revealed that CaM residues Thr-110, Leu-112, and Lys-115 were critical for full smMLCK activation and could not be substituted by the corresponding cTnC residue (Gln, Thr, and Thr, respectively). In contrast, only the L112T substitution significantly affected PDE activation. The CaM-smMLCK peptide structure (Meador, W. E., Means, A. R., and Quiocho, F. A. (1992) Science 257, 1251-1255) suggests a relationship between the proposed helix 6 smMLCK-activating residues and those previously described in helix 2 (VanBerkum, M. F. A., and Means, A. R. (1991) J. Biol. Chem. 266, 21488-21495).

Ling Q, Guo ZG, Su Z, Guo X. Regression of cardiac hypertrophy and myosin isoenzyme patterns by losartan and captopril in renovascular hypertensive rats. Abstract
To test the effect of losartan and captopril on cardiac hypertrophy and myosin isoenzyme, two-kidney, one-clip (2K 1C) renovascular hypertensive rats (RHR) were used. Eight weeks after the onset of hypertension, losartan 5 mg.kg-1.d-1 and captopril 50 mg.kg-1.d-1 were administered p.o. to 2 groups of RHR, respectively for 8 wk. The results showed that captopril significantly decreased the cardiac mass (607 +/- 169 mg vs 1029 +/- 132 mg) and total protein content (120 +/- 38 mg vs 198 +/- 31 mg), concomitant with significant decrease of arterial blood pressure (BP) (15.4 +/- 5.2 kPa vs 28.5 +/- 4.9 kPa). Losartan also induced a significant decrease in cardiac mass (671 +/- 116 mg vs 1029 +/- 132 mg) and protein content (142 +/- 29 mg vs 198 +/- 31 mg), as well as significantly lowered the BP (15.2 +/- 2.1 kPa vs 28.5 +/- 4.9 kPa). It is important to be note that both drugs normalized the shift of myosin isoenzyme in RHR. These results indicated that both drugs, having potent antihypertensive effects, can effectively reverse the cardiac hypertrophy and abnormal distribution of myosin isoenzyme patterns.

Su Z, Li YJ, Yan XD, Chen X. Prostacyclin analog (cicaprost) protects against damage by hydrogen peroxide to rabbit cardiac sarcoplasmic reticulum. CARDIOSCIENCE 1994; 5:51-4. Abstract
The membrane fluidity of the cardiac sarcoplasmic reticulum in rabbit was monitored by measuring changes in steady-state fluorescence anisotropy (rs) using diphenylhexatriene as a probe. The Ca(2+)-ATPase activity of the sarcoplasmic reticulum was measured by assaying the amount of inorganic phosphate released from ATP. Hydrogen peroxide caused damage to the sarcoplasmic reticulum, as reflected by decreases in membrane fluidity and Ca(2+)-ATPase activity. The damage caused by hydrogen peroxide was completely prevented by 20 micrograms/ml catalase. Cicaprost (240 nM) provided an effective protection against injury to the sarcoplasmic reticulum caused by exposure to hydrogen peroxide. The rs value was significantly decreased from 0.154 +/- 0.014 to 0.122 +/- 0.005 (p < 0.01). Ca(2+)-ATPase activity was increased from 3.1 +/- 1.31 to 18.87 +/- 2.11 microM phosphate/mg protein/hour (p < 0.01). The protection given by cicaprost was dose dependent. We conclude that cicaprost protects against damage produced by hydrogen peroxide in cardiac sarcoplasmic reticulum in the rabbit. The mechanism of the effect of cicaprost remains to be elucidated.

Offenzeller M, Su Z, Santer G, Moser H, Traber R, Memmert K, Schneider-Scherzer E. Biosynthesis of the unusual amino acid (4R)-4-[(E)-2-butenyl]-4-methyl-L-threonine of cyclosporin A. Identification of 3(R)-hydroxy-4(R)-methyl-6(E)-octenoic acid as a key intermediate by enzymatic in vitro synthesis and by in vivo labeling techniques. J Biol Chem 1993; 268:26127-34. Abstract
The biosynthesis of (4R)-4-[(E)-2-butenyl]-4-methyl-L-threonine (abbreviation: Bmt, systematic name: 2(S)-amino-3(R)-hydroxy-4(R)-methyl-6(E)-octenoic acid) is proposed to involve two principal phases: the formation of a polyketide backbone and a subsequent transformation process to the final product. Here we report on the identification of 3(R)-hydroxy-4(R)-methyl-6(E)-octenoic acid as the end product of the first phase. The primary indication of 3(R)-hydroxy-4(R)-methyl-6(E)-octenoic acid as the key intermediate in the proposed biosynthetic route came from in vivo labeling studies with [1-13C,18O2]acetate, demonstrating retention of 18O in the 3-hydroxy group. Final identification of this intermediate in in vitro polyketide assays with enriched enzyme fractions of Tolypocladium niveum was achieved after development of highly sensitive and specific detection methods and by use of synthetic reference substances. Two additional methylated in vitro products could be detected and characterized as 4(R)-methyl-(E,E)-2,6-octadienoic acid and 4(R)-methyl-6(E)-octenoic acid by liquid chromatography-mass spectrometry analysis and comparison with synthetic reference samples. Their relevance for Bmt biosynthesis is discussed. Bmt polyketide synthase shows optimal activity at substrate concentrations of 200 microM acetyl-CoA, 150 microM malonyl-CoA, and 200 microM S-adenosylmethionine, around pH 7 and at 35 degrees C. Interestingly the Bmt backbone is released from the enzyme as a coenzyme A thioester, suggesting that subsequent transformation to Bmt takes place upon this activated intermediate.

George SE, Su Z, Fan D, Means AR. Calmodulin-cardiac troponin C chimeras. Effects of domain exchange on calcium binding and enzyme activation. J Biol Chem 1993; 268:25213-20. Abstract
Calmodulin (CaM) and the cardiac isoform of troponin C (cTnC) are close structural homologs, but cTnC cannot activate most CaM target enzymes. To investigate structure-function relationships, we constructed a series of CaM.cTnC chimeras and determined their ability to bind Ca2+ and activate CaM target enzymes. Previously, we exchanged domain 1 and found that the chimeras exhibited profoundly impaired activation of smooth muscle myosin light chain kinase (smMLCK) and had differential effects on other CaM target enzymes (George, S. E., VanBerkum, M. F. A., Ono, T., Cook, R., Hanley, R. M., Putkey, J. A., and Means, A. R. (1990) J. Biol. Chem. 265, 9228-9235). One of the domain 1 chimeras was a potent competitive inhibitor of smMLCK. We now extend our study of CaM.cTnC chimeras by exchanging all of the remaining functional domains of CaM and cTnC. We determined the ability of the chimeras to bind Ca2+ and activate phosphodiesterase (PDE) and smMLCK. Chimeras containing both domains 3 and 4 of cTnC exhibited high affinity Ca2+ binding that was indistinguishable from cTnC, whereas chimeras containing either domain 3 or 4 of cTnC demonstrated Ca2+ affinity that was intermediate between CaM and cTnC. All of the CaM.cTnC chimeras showed near-maximal PDE activation but required 5-775-fold higher concentrations than CaM to produce half-maximal PDE activation. In contrast, all of the chimeras showed impaired ability to activate smMLCK, and some were potent competitive inhibitors of smMLCK activation by CaM.

Su Z, Yan XD, Li YJ, Chen X. Effects of hydrogen peroxide on membrane fluidity and Ca(2+)-transporting ATPase activity of rabbit myocardial sarcoplasmic reticulum. Abstract
This study was to investigate the effects of hydrogen peroxide on membrane fluidity and Ca(2+)-ATPase activity of rabbit myocardial sarcoplasmic reticulum (SR). The membrane fluidity of SR was monitored by measuring the changes in the steady state fluorescence anisotropies (rs) using diphenylhexatriene as a probe. The Ca(2+)-ATPase activity was determined by assaying the amount of inorganic phosphate (Pi) released from ATP. It was found that the membrane fluidity (rs: 0.154 +/- 0.014 vs 0.113 +/- 0.010, P < 0.01) and Ca(2+)-ATPase activity (3.1 +/- 1.3 vs 25.3 +/- 2.4 mumol Pi.h-1/mg protein, P < 0.01) were reduced in SR exposed to H2O2 (2 mmol.L-1) for 40 min. Catalase 20 micrograms.ml-1 completely prevented the SR damages caused by H2O2. H2O2 jeopardized the SR in a concentration- and time-dependent manner as measured by changes in rs values and Ca(2+)-ATPase activities, which were negatively correlated (r = 0.981, P < 0.01). These results suggest that H2O2 produces dysfunctions of the rabbit myocardial SR, and that the alteration of membrane fluidity may be one of the mechanisms responsible for the decrease of Ca(2+)-ATPase activity.

Su Z, Guo Y, Peng Z. Production of intracellular enzyme by Corynebacterium glutamicum T6-13 protoplasts immobilized in Ca-alginate gels. Enzyme Microb Technol 1993; 15:791-5. Abstract
The glutamate dehydrogenase (GDH) (EC 1.4.1.4) productivity of the immobilized Corynebacterium glutamicum T6-13 protoplasts in Ca-alginate gels was investigated. GDH in Corynebacterium glutamicum T6-13 cells is an intracellular enzyme. The cells pretreated with 0.5 U/l-1 penicillin G were used for the preparation of protoplasts. Protoplasts were prepared by treating these cells with lysozyme at 30 degrees C for 14 h in 0.5 M NaCl solution and separating the protoplasts. Protoplasts were directly immobilized in 3% Ca-alginate gels (method I). The immobilized protoplasts could be also prepared by treating the immobilized whole cells with lysozyme (method II); this method was more convenient than method I. The GDH productivity of the immobilized protoplasts amounted to 205% of that of the free cells (intracellular). The immobilized protoplasts could be repeatedly used for at least 6 batches (18 days) and had good storage stability.

Huang H, Ding W, Su Z, Zhang W. Mechanism of the preserving effect of aprotinin on platelet function and its use in cardiac surgery. J Thorac Cardiovasc Surg 1993; 106:11-8. Abstract
The deficiency of platelet function is the main defect of the hemostatic mechanism during cardiopulmonary bypass, which greatly exacerbates the postoperative bleeding complications. In this study, we assessed, from basic and clinical perspectives, the mechanism of relieving platelet damage by means of aprotinin. In vitro research confirmed that the addition of urokinase (40 U/ml) to platelet-rich plasma and the addition of plasmin (0.3 U/ml) to washed platelets made ristocetin-induced agglutination decline to 31.6% and 38.5% of control values, respectively. The extent of decline was positively correlated with the concentration of urokinase and plasmin. In addition, the platelet membrane glycoprotein Ib decreased to 76.4% of control value. With the addition of urokinase or plasmin to aprotinin-pretreated platelet-rich plasma or washed platelets, the changes in agglutination are not statistically significant and the decrement in glycoprotein Ib is much less marked. Further in vivo research revealed that cardiopulmonary bypass caused a decrease in plasma alpha 2-antiplasmin, indicating the fibrinolytic system activation. Meanwhile, ristocetin-induced agglutination decreased to 39.6% and platelet glycoprotein Ib decreased to 50% of preoperative values. However, with the administration of aprotinin, plasma alpha 2-antiplasmin during cardiopulmonary bypass did not change; platelet agglutination was improved, platelet glycoprotein Ib was preserved, and this consequently resulted in 46% lower blood loss after the operation. The results showed that fibrinolysis impaired platelet function, and this effect may be associated with the hydrolysis of glycoprotein Ib. Fibrinolytic activation occurred during cardiopulmonary bypass and contributed to postoperative platelet dysfunction to a great extent. Aprotinin may inhibit fibrinolysis during cardiopulmonary bypass and thus relieve the platelet damage and improve the postoperative hemostatic mechanism.

MacLean JA, Su Z, Guo Y, Sy MS, Colvin RB, Wong JT. Anti-CD3:anti-IL-2 receptor bispecific monoclonal antibody. Targeting of activated T cells in vitro. Abstract
T cells are major mediators of graft rejection and many autoimmune diseases. During the Ag recognition process, T cells often become activated. We tested the hypothesis that an anti-CD3:anti-CD25 (CD3,25) bispecific mAb (BSMAB) can effectively and selectively target activated T cells. By flow cytometric analysis, the CD3,25 BSMAB was shown to bind avidly to activated T cells that coexpress CD3 and CD25 (p55 chain of the IL-2R), achieving higher levels than the parent anti-CD3 and anti-CD25 mAb. It bound only weakly to unstimulated T cells. The CD3,25 BSMAB effectively redirected CTL to lyse CD25-bearing PHA-stimulated T lymphoblasts and the IL2-dependent CTLL tumor cell line in chromium release assays. It was highly effective in blocking MLR as shown by inhibition of [3H]TdR incorporation. However, the CD3,25 BSMAB has a low potential to activate resting T cells, as it induced only minimal [3H]TdR incorporation even in the presence of exogenous IL-2. In the absence of exogenous IL-2, the CD3,25 BSMAB was unable to induce [3H]TdR incorporation. In contrast, the parent anti-CD3 mAb induced a high degree of incorporation. In summary, the CD3,25 BSMAB selectively targets activated CD25-expressing T cells and lymphomas although maintaining a low activation potential for unstimulated T cells, potentially advantageous properties that can be exploited for immunotherapy.

Obermaier-Kusser B, White MF, Pongratz DE, Su Z, Ermel B, Muhlbacher C, Haring HU. A defective intramolecular autoactivation cascade may cause the reduced kinase activity of the skeletal muscle insulin receptor from patients with non-insulin-dependent diabetes mellitus. J Biol Chem 1989; 264:9497-504. Abstract
The insulin receptor purified from skeletal muscle of patients with non-insulin-dependent diabetes mellitus (NIDDM) displayed a 25-55% reduction in insulin-stimulated autophosphorylation and tyrosyl-specific phosphotransferase activity relative to controls. This decrease was not explained by alterations of muscle fiber composition, insulin binding affinity or capacity, or the Km values for ATP; the lower kinase activity was entirely attributed to a decrease in the Vmax of the enzyme. Phosphorylation sites in the beta-subunit of the control and diabetic receptor were identified by tryptic digestion and reverse-phase high performance liquid chromatography. Autophosphorylation occurred primarily in two regions of the beta-subunit: the regulatory region containing Tyr-1146, Tyr-1150, and Tyr-1151, and the C terminus containing Tyr-1316 and 1322. Autophosphorylation of the regulatory region at all three tyrosyl residues (tris-phosphorylation) appears to be necessary to activate the receptor kinase (White, M. F., Shoelson, S. E., Stepman, E. W., Keutmann, H. & Kahn, C. R. (1988) J. Biol. Chem. 263, 2969-2980). The receptor from NIDDM patients showed a decreased level of tris-phosphorylation of the regulatory region which was closely associated (r2 = 0.97) with the decreased kinase activity. In contrast, weak associations were found between kinase activity and the bis-phosphorylated forms of the regulatory region (r2 = 0.51) and the C terminus (r2 = 0.35). Therefore, the reduced formation of the tris-phosphorylated regulatory region in the diabetic receptors suggests that a defective autophosphorylation cascade leading to tris-phosphorylation of the regulatory region may cause, in part, the reduced insulin-stimulated kinase activity of the insulin receptor in muscle of NIDDM patients.
